Webbdevelopment and career opportunities (Hill et al., 2012; West, 2010); sharing good practice and innovation (Stoll, 2015; Chapman et al., 2009a); reductions and realignments in headteacher workload (alleviating burnout and facilitating succession) and organisational and financial efficiency as a consequence of inter-school collaboration Webb21 mars 2024 · A useful technique if you need an agreement between 2 or more conflicting stakeholders is to write out both views in advance and organise a meeting with both parties to discuss. The reason for this is they might not realise there is a conflict and tell you it is resolved when they haven’t. Going through with each party how each of their …

Webb8) Compromise. The initial step is to establish the most acceptable baseline across a set of stakeholders' diverging expectations and priorities. Assess the relative importance of all stakeholders to establish a weighted hierarchy against the project requirements and agreed by the project Sponsor. Example resources:
